Chichghat
Chichghat is a village located in Pusad tehsil of Yavatmal district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 27km away from sub-district headquarter Pusad (tehsildar office) and 118km away from district headquarter Yavatmal. As per 2009 stats, Chichghat village is also a gram panchayat.

About Chichghat
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Chichghat is 542739. The village spans a total geographical area of 170 hectares. Pusad is nearest town to Chichghat village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 27km away.

Population of Chichghat
According to the 2011 Census, Chichghat has a total population of about 929, with approximately 478 males and 451 females. The sex ratio is around 943 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 122 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 95 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 227. The overall literacy rate is approximately 69.11%, with male literacy at about 79.08% and female literacy near 58.54%. There are around 208 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 929 | 478 | 451 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 122 | 62 | 60 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 95 | 46 | 49 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 227 | 120 | 107 |
Literate Population | 642 | 378 | 264 |
Illiterate Population | 287 | 100 | 187 |
Connectivity of Chichghat
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Chichghat. As per the 2011 stats, Chichghat had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
